阿里云轻量应用服务器不是只能安装一个网站,它可以部署多个网站或应用,但相比ECS(弹性计算服务)来说,在管理和灵活性上略有不同。下面详细解释:
✅ 轻量应用服务器可以安装多个网站吗?
是的,可以安装多个网站,但需要注意以下几点:
1. 端口限制与域名绑定
- 轻量服务器默认提供的是标准Web端口(如80、443),你可以通过配置Nginx/Apache等Web服务器软件来实现多域名绑定,从而运行多个网站。
- 每个网站可以通过不同的域名访问,共享同一个IP地址。
2. 镜像类型影响
- 如果你使用的是应用镜像(如WordPress镜像),通常预装了特定环境,适合快速部署单一应用。
- 如果你需要部署多个网站,建议选择系统镜像(如CentOS、Ubuntu)自行搭建LNMP/LAMP环境,这样更灵活。
3. 资源限制
- 轻量服务器一般配置较低(如1核2G),如果多个网站流量较大,可能会导致性能不足。
- 建议根据实际需求合理分配资源,避免超负荷。
4. 防火墙和安全组
- 确保防火墙/安全组规则允许必要的端口(如80、443、自定义端口等)。
- 可以通过不同端口运行多个Web应用(例如:http://yourip:8080、http://yourip:3000)。
🛠️ 如何在轻量服务器上部署多个网站?
方法一:使用Nginx虚拟主机配置
# 站点1配置
server {
listen 80;
server_name site1.com www.site1.com;
location / {
root /var/www/site1;
index index.html;
}
}
# 站点2配置
server {
listen 80;
server_name site2.com www.site2.com;
location / {
root /var/www/site2;
index index.html;
}
}
然后重启 Nginx:
systemctl restart nginx
方法二:使用Docker容器化部署
如果你熟悉 Docker,可以为每个网站创建独立的容器,实现隔离部署。
🔍 总结
| 项目 | 轻量服务器是否支持 |
|---|---|
| 安装多个网站 | ✅ 支持(需手动配置) |
| 多域名绑定 | ✅ 支持 |
| 使用Docker | ✅ 支持 |
| 高性能并发 | ❌ 相对有限 |
| 灵活性 | ⚠️ 不如ECS |
✅ 推荐做法:
- 如果只是展示类的小型网站,用轻量服务器部署多个没问题。
- 如果需要高并发或多项目开发运维,建议使用ECS服务器。
如果你告诉我你使用的具体镜像(比如宝塔、Ubuntu、CentOS等),我可以给你更详细的部署步骤 😊
云计算HECS